Possible Causes Leading to Pulmonary Artery Thromboembolism

The main cause of possible thromboembolism is thrombosis. A dislodged thrombus from a large vessel can block the lumen of the pulmonary artery and cause obstruction. Patients with: thrombophlebitis, varicose veins, increased blood coagulability, loss of circulating blood volume (trauma and bleeding) may be at risk. Thromboembolism can be caused by trauma to large tubular bones with vascular damage; surgical intervention associated with bleeding; prolonged immobility of the patient due to paralysis, oncological processes, etc.

According to recent data, thromboembolism is more common in people with blood type II and those suffering from obesity. Patients in the risk group are advised to undergo periodic examinations and consult a specialist.

Treatment Measures for Pulmonary Artery Thromboembolism at the Top Ichilov Clinic

Pulmonary Artery ThromboembolismIn the intensive care unit at Top Ichilov, a special algorithm for the urgent treatment of thromboembolism is actively used. Along with life-saving measures, medications that reduce blood coagulability and promote thrombus dissolution (plasminogen activator, fibrinolysin, and others) are administered. Special endovascular equipment allows for the introduction of medications directly into the affected vessel, removal of the thrombus, and other manipulations within the vessel. All these procedures are performed under the control of computer technology, with the specialist's actions projected onto a monitor screen with magnification.

For life-threatening indications, the patient undergoes surgical removal of the thrombus, with simultaneous placement of a cava filter in the inferior vena cava to protect the vessel from recurrent thromboembolism.

Diagnostic Measures Conducted for Pulmonary Artery Thromboembolism

The condition of a patient with pulmonary artery thromboembolism is critical and requires urgent medical assistance. The patient is immediately hospitalized in the intensive care unit, and life-support monitoring equipment is connected. Within minutes, the patient undergoes: lung scintigraphy and angiography with contrast, immediately determining the location of the thrombus and the extent of vessel damage. CT and MRI, as well as other endovascular examinations, are also performed.
